Education Committee
The Education Committee reviews and recommends classes, seminars, and continuing education.

Finance/Investment
The Finance/Investment Committee reviews financial reports and makes budget, policy and investment recommendations to the Board of Directors.

Governmental Affairs
The Governmental Affairs Committee works to create awareness of legislation affecting the real estate industry, promotes the importance of RPAC and makes candidate endorsement recommendations.

MLS Committee
The MLS Committee reviews and recommends MLS policy, rules and regulations and MLS products and services.

Grievance Committee
The Grievance Committee meets as needed to review complaints alleging Code of Ethics violations and requests for arbitration.

Community Involvement Committee
The Community Involvement Committee will identify opportunities for the Board and members to support community organizations and housing related activities.
